Tomorrow Nelson Mandela is 91. In honour of his birthday South Africa has created the Annual ' Madiba' Day (his nickname). He has suggested that it is a day in which people go out into the community to see what they can do to make a difference. How fitting that Ronda will be distributing 60 blankets at Phiri Parish tomorrow (look forward to a story about this in the next ezine).
